Advance: Javier Gómez Noya wins in Cape Town. Mario Mola 4º.

Javier Gómez Noya won the second round of the triathlon world series in Cape Town, which hosted this event for the first time.

 

 

Noya has won with a final time of 1: 44: 52 followed in second position of the British Jonathan Brownlee  to 19 '' and Russian Dimitry Polyansky.  Mario Mola He has achieved a great fourth place.

 

With this victory Javier Gómez Noya leads the world ranking with a distance of 120 points over the British Jonathan Brownlee.

 

Elite Men

1. Javier Gomez Noya ESP 01:44:52
2. Jonathan Brownlee GBR 01:45:11
3. Dmitry Polyanskiy RUS 01:45:35
4. Mario Mola ESP 01:45:44
5. Richard Murray RSA 01:45:57
6. Aaron Royle AUS 01:46:05
7. Aaron Harris GBR 01:46:06
8. Vincent Luis FRA 01:46:10
9. Joao Pereira POR 01:46:12
10. Ryan Sissons NZL 01:46:17
